> This does not look like a bug to me.
>
> The configure script is telling you that the lua library is present,
> but it can not find the matching lua.h file.
> There are 2 possible reasons.
>
>
> 1) It could be because you have not installed the *-devel version of the
> library
> to match the library itself
>
> On my machine that is liblua5.2-5.2.3 and lib64lua-devel-5.2.3
> but you may have a different version. (The config output you show
> mentions lua5.1).
>
> 2) Alternatively, you may correctly have the lua.h file installed but it is in
> a directory not on the default search path.
> That is why the script output suggests
> configure: WARNING: please add path to lua.h to CPPFLAGS in Makefile
>
> Of course as you say it is also possible to configure --without-lua
> but then you will not be able to use the tikz terminal.
> It would be better to install or identify the lua.h file.
